How to correctly change sprite on a prefab clone?
Hello Community, I have made a script so that when the Linecast between the mouse cursor and the player hits a gameobject ("Int_Molecule") it changes its sprite into a new one.
public class CursorXhair : MonoBehaviour
{
public Player Player;
public AttachmentController Molecule;
//public SpriteRenderer spriteRenderer;
public Sprite newSprite;
public Sprite originalSprite;
// Update is called once per frame
void Update()
{
Vector2 playerPos = Player.transform.position;
Vector2 mousePos = Camera.main.ScreenToWorldPoint(Input.mousePosition);
Vector2 direction = mousePos - playerPos;
transform.position = mousePos;
Debug.DrawRay(playerPos, direction);
RaycastHit2D mouse2Player = Physics2D.Linecast(mousePos, playerPos);
if (mouse2Player.collider != null && mouse2Player.collider.tag == "Int_Molecule")
{
Debug.Log("mouse2Player is colling");
Molecule.spriteRenderer.sprite = newSprite;
}
else
{
Molecule.spriteRenderer.sprite = originalSprite;
Debug.Log("mouse2Player is NOT colling");
}
}
}
Since I need multiple clones instantiation of this same object I create this script and assign it to a LevelManager. So I create a prefab as the original object to instantiate. The Linecast works as expected as you can see in the two images, however the clones do not update the sprite as expected. Interestingly the prefab in the prefab folder does update (see the last image), but the update is not reflected in the running game and the clones instantiations.
public class MoleculeInstantiator : MonoBehaviour
{
public GameObject molecule;
//public Transform moleculeLocation;
// Start is called before the first frame update
void Start()
{
Instantiate(molecule, new Vector2(-1, 6), Quaternion.identity);
Instantiate(molecule, new Vector2(-11, 2), Quaternion.identity);
Instantiate(molecule, new Vector2(9, -6), Quaternion.identity);
Instantiate(molecule, new Vector2(14, 3), Quaternion.identity);
Instantiate(molecule, new Vector2(-14, -7), Quaternion.identity);
Instantiate(molecule, new Vector2(-17, 6), Quaternion.identity);
Instantiate(molecule, new Vector2(17, -9), Quaternion.identity);
}
}
Is there something I am doing wrong or in the wrong order?
I am thinking that the best way would be to have the two scripts above as one attached to the prefab (and therefore the clones), but I preferred to keep the two scripts separated for better tidiness.
Would that solve it or am I missing the point?
